Fresh Turmeric
Also known as: Turmeric, fresh turmeric root, Curcumin, Curcuma longa
Overview
Fresh turmeric is the raw rhizome of *Curcuma longa*, a plant widely utilized as both a culinary spice and a traditional medicine. Its primary bioactive compounds are curcuminoids, with curcumin being the most prominent. These compounds are responsible for turmeric's well-documented anti-inflammatory, antioxidant, and metabolic regulatory properties. It is primarily used for managing inflammatory conditions such as arthritis, metabolic disorders like type 2 diabetes, and gastrointestinal diseases including inflammatory bowel disease. Research on turmeric and its active compounds is extensive, with numerous randomized controlled trials, systematic reviews, and meta-analyses supporting its efficacy. While variability exists in turmeric preparations and dosages, the evidence quality for some indications ranges from moderate to high, particularly for metabolic and inflammatory outcomes.
Benefits
Turmeric, primarily through its active compound curcumin, offers several evidence-based health benefits: * **Metabolic Health:** Curcumin supplementation significantly improves glycemic control in individuals with type 2 diabetes and metabolic syndrome. Studies show reductions in fasting blood glucose (mean difference ~ -8.1 mg/dL) and HbA1c (~ -0.13%), indicating its role in blood sugar regulation. This benefit is supported by high-quality umbrella reviews and meta-analyses. * **Arthritis Symptom Reduction:** Meta-analyses of randomized controlled trials demonstrate that curcumin, typically at doses around 1000 mg/day, significantly reduces symptoms of arthritis, including pain and functional limitations as measured by WOMAC scores. Its efficacy is comparable to some standard pain medications, with a low to moderate risk of bias in the supporting research. * **Inflammatory Bowel Disease (IBD) Improvement:** Curcumin has shown promise in improving clinical outcomes for patients with ulcerative colitis and Crohn’s disease. Doses ranging from 0.1 to 10 g/day over 1-6 months, often used as an adjunct to conventional therapy, have been effective. This benefit is supported by systematic reviews and meta-analyses. * **Lipid Profile Modulation:** Supplementation with turmeric has been shown to reduce total cholesterol levels by approximately 7.8 mg/dL. This effect is beneficial in conditions such as metabolic-associated fatty liver disease (MAFLD), polycystic ovary syndrome (PCOS), and diabetes, contributing to overall cardiovascular health. Benefits typically manifest over weeks to months, depending on the specific condition and dosage.
How it works
Curcumin, the primary active compound in turmeric, exerts its therapeutic effects by modulating multiple biological pathways. It significantly inhibits the NF-κB signaling pathway, a key regulator of inflammatory responses, thereby reducing the production of pro-inflammatory mediators. Curcumin also acts as a potent antioxidant, scavenging reactive oxygen species and protecting cells from oxidative damage. Furthermore, it improves insulin sensitivity, which contributes to its metabolic benefits, and modulates lipid metabolism, leading to improved cholesterol profiles. Its interactions with inflammatory cytokines, enzymes like COX-2 and LOX, and various transcription factors collectively contribute to its systemic anti-inflammatory and metabolic effects. It's important to note that curcumin's bioavailability is inherently low, and formulations with bioenhancers like piperine or nanomicelles are often used to improve absorption.
Side effects
Turmeric and curcumin are generally considered safe, with a low incidence of adverse effects reported in clinical trials. The most common side effects, occurring in more than 5% of users, are mild gastrointestinal disturbances such as nausea and diarrhea. Less common side effects, affecting 1-5% of individuals, include headache and skin rash. Rare side effects, occurring in less than 1% of users, may include allergic reactions. While no significant drug interactions have been consistently reported in well-controlled studies, caution is advised when co-administering turmeric with anticoagulants (blood thinners) and antiplatelet drugs due to its potential to inhibit platelet aggregation, which could theoretically increase the risk of bleeding. Contraindications include known hypersensitivity to turmeric or curcumin. Due to limited research, pregnant and breastfeeding individuals should exercise caution and consult a healthcare professional before using turmeric supplements. Overall, turmeric has a favorable safety profile, but users should be aware of potential mild GI upset and exercise caution with certain medications.
Dosage
The minimum effective dose of curcumin for conditions like arthritis and metabolic issues is approximately 500 mg per day. The optimal dose range for curcumin typically falls between 500 mg to 2 grams per day, depending on the specific health condition being addressed and the formulation used. For certain conditions, such as inflammatory bowel disease, doses up to 10 grams per day of curcumin have been reported in trials with good tolerance. Dosing should generally be daily, often in divided doses, to maintain consistent levels. Bioavailability of curcumin is enhanced when taken with meals or when formulated with bioenhancers like piperine. It's crucial to note that fresh turmeric root contains a significantly lower concentration of curcumin compared to standardized extracts. Therefore, a much larger quantity of fresh turmeric would be required to achieve the same therapeutic dose of curcumin found in concentrated supplements. While generally well-tolerated, adherence to recommended dosages is important, and higher doses should only be considered under professional guidance.
FAQs
Is fresh turmeric as effective as curcumin extract?
Fresh turmeric contains curcumin but at lower concentrations. Standardized extracts provide a more consistent and higher dose of curcumin, making them generally more effective for therapeutic purposes.
How soon do benefits appear?
Clinical improvements from turmeric supplementation typically become noticeable within 4 to 12 weeks, though the exact timeframe can vary depending on the specific condition and the dosage used.
Is it safe long-term?
Turmeric is generally considered safe for long-term use at recommended doses. However, long-term safety data for very high doses are limited, and consultation with a healthcare provider is advisable for prolonged use.
Can turmeric replace medications?
Turmeric may complement prescribed treatments for various conditions, but it should not replace conventional medications without explicit medical advice from a qualified healthcare professional.
Research Sources
- https://journals.plos.org/plosone/article?id=10.1371%2Fjournal.pone.0288997 – This umbrella review and updated meta-analysis of 28 randomized controlled trials found that Curcuma longa supplementation significantly reduces fasting glucose by approximately 8 mg/dL and HbA1c by about 0.13% in adults with type 2 diabetes, prediabetes, and metabolic syndrome. The study highlights the efficacy of turmeric in improving glycemic control, despite some heterogeneity in turmeric forms and study overlap, indicating a high-quality and comprehensive synthesis of evidence.
- https://www.liebertpub.com/doi/10.1089/jmf.2016.3705 – This systematic review and meta-analysis of 8 randomized controlled trials involving arthritis patients demonstrated that turmeric extract, at doses around 1000 mg/day of curcumin, significantly reduces arthritis pain and improves WOMAC scores over durations ranging from 4 weeks to 4 months. The findings suggest consistent effects in pain reduction, although the study noted a moderate risk of bias and a relatively small number of included RCTs.
- https://www.frontiersin.org/journals/nutrition/articles/10.3389/fnut.2025.1494351/full – This systematic review and meta-analysis of 13 randomized controlled trials on IBD patients (Ulcerative Colitis and Crohn's Disease) concluded that oral curcumin, at doses ranging from 0.1 to 10 g/day over 1-6 months, improves clinical outcomes in mild-to-moderate cases. The research indicates curcumin's potential as an adjunctive therapy, despite limitations such as small sample sizes and variable formulations across studies, suggesting moderate to high quality evidence for its use.
